Founded in 1989, Soromundi (meaning sisters of the world) is a non-auditioned community chorus in Eugene that comes together in song as a visible expression of lesbian pride. Membership is open to anyone 18 or older who identifies as a woman, with an explicitly broad definition that includes lesbian, straight, bisexual, cisgender, transgender, and intersex women, people with non-binary gender expressions, and gender-expansive individuals who find home in women's spaces. The chorus performs at concerts and at rallies, marches, and vigils. Join through the website.
